Output 723f57b679e9869529d8f7711ea1ccb0bbb026b7578cad3cc04c27a320560523:0

value
58962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10fbd63b05739bfa20e87e6513cd3eb8a93db360 OP_EQUAL
address
33EpRYTx58yRx7iKkQShMn8zYmLySwsJRB
transaction
723f57b679e9869529d8f7711ea1ccb0bbb026b7578cad3cc04c27a320560523
spent
true